Real Madrid: The Kings of Europe

Real Madrid, often referred to as 'Los Blancos' (The Whites), is synonymous with success. Based in the Spanish capital, Madrid is the club that has defined European football. They have won a record 14 UEFA Champions League titles, a feat that showcases their dominance and enduring ability to compete at the highest level. From the era of Alfredo Di Stéfano to the galácticos era of Zidane, Ronaldo, and Figo, Real Madrid has always been home to some of the world's most talented players. Juventus: The Old Lady of Turin

Across the continent in Turin, Italy, Juventus reigns as one of the most successful clubs in the Serie A, affectionately known as 'La Vecchia Signora' (The Old Lady). Juventus has a long and distinguished history, marked by domestic dominance and a fervent fanbase. With a record number of Serie A titles, Juventus is a symbol of consistency and resilience in Italian football. The club has always attracted top talent, from Michel Platini to Alessandro Del Piero to Cristiano Ronaldo, creating teams that are both skillful and tactically astute. Cristiano Ronaldo's Bicycle Kick

One of the most iconic moments in this rivalry occurred during a Champions League match in 2018. Cristiano Ronaldo, then playing for Real Madrid, scored a stunning bicycle kick against Juventus. The goal was so incredible that even Juventus fans applauded. It showed the level of respect between the two clubs and the appreciation for true talent. Real Madrid's Icons

Real Madrid has always been home to some of the greatest players in football history. Alfredo Di Stéfano, the man who shaped their early dominance, and Ferenc Puskás, known for his incredible goal-scoring ability, are forever etched in club folklore. In more recent times, players like Zinedine Zidane, Cristiano Ronaldo, and Sergio Ramos have become synonymous with Real Madrid's success. Zidane was the epitome of elegance. Ronaldo's goal-scoring records speak for themselves. Ramos embodied the team’s spirit and leadership. Each of these players has contributed to the club's legacy. Juventus' Stars

Juventus has also been graced by many legendary figures who have defined the club's character and success. Michel Platini, one of the greatest midfielders of all time, and Alessandro Del Piero, a symbol of loyalty and skill, are revered as club icons. Gianluigi Buffon, with his longevity and goalkeeping prowess, is a pillar of the team. Cristiano Ronaldo also played for Juventus, adding to the excitement of matches between the two clubs.
